Abstract

Unsymmetrical dihydrodithiazines of the formula ##STR1## in which one of the substituents R.sub.1 and R.sub.2 represent a C.sub.3 -C.sub.5 -alkyl group while the other is a methyl group and R.sub.3 represents a hydrogen atom, or R.sub.1 represents a methyl group and R.sub.2 and R.sub.3 together form a C.sub.3 -C.sub.4 -alkylene radical, a process for their preparation and their use as fragrances and flavorings.
